Truck accidents often involve significant forces, leading to the potential for traumatic brain injuries (TBIs). Even with advancements in vehicle safety technology, the sheer size and weight of trucks can result in violent collisions. TBIs can range from mild concussions to severe brain damage, impacting cognitive functions, memory, and overall quality of life. Seeking immediate medical attention is vital, as TBIs may not manifest symptoms immediately after an accident.

Spinal Cord Injuries

The spine is particularly vulnerable in truck accidents, given the impact forces involved. Spinal cord injuries can lead to paralysis, affecting mobility and independence. Victims may face a lifetime of medical challenges and extensive rehabilitation. Bone Fractures and Orthopedic Injuries

Truck accidents often result in high-velocity collisions, causing bone fractures and orthopedic injuries. From broken limbs to fractures in the spine or pelvis, the range of orthopedic injuries can be extensive. The recovery process may involve surgeries, physical therapy, and long periods of rehabilitation. Victims may experience chronic pain and limited mobility, impacting their ability to work and enjoy daily activities

Internal Injuries

The internal organs of the human body are susceptible to damage in a truck accident. The force of impact can lead to injuries such as organ perforation, internal bleeding, or damage to vital organs. Internal injuries may not always be immediately apparent, underscoring the importance of thorough medical evaluations following a truck accident. Identifying and treating internal injuries promptly is crucial for a victim’s overall health and well-being.

Whiplash and Neck Injuries

Whiplash is a common injury in any motor vehicle accident, and truck accidents are no exception. The sudden jerking motion upon impact can cause strain and damage to the neck’s soft tissues. Symptoms may include neck pain, stiffness, headaches, and even cognitive issues. While whiplash is often considered a less severe injury, it can still have a significant impact on a person’s daily life and may require medical treatment and rehabilitation.

Psychological Trauma

The aftermath of a truck accident can lead to psychological trauma for the victims. Anxiety, depression, post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D), and other mental health issues can manifest as a result of the traumatic experience. Recognizing and addressing these psychological effects is essential for a comprehensive recovery. Statute of Limitations

In Colorado, there is a statute of limitations that dictates the time frame within which a personal injury lawsuit must be filed. For truck accidents, victims generally have two years from the date of the accident to file a lawsuit. It is essential to initiate legal proceedings promptly to preserve your right to compensation.

Comparative Negligence

Colorado follows a modified comparative negligence system, meaning that the compensation a victim receives may be reduced if they are found partially at fault for the accident. Understanding how this system works is vital for building a case that withstands legal scrutiny. Insurance Requirements

Colorado law requires all motor vehicle operators, including commercial truck drivers, to carry liability insurance. Victims injured in truck accidents can seek compensation through the at-fault party’s insurance.
